body {  font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 12px; color: #333333}
td {  font-size: 12px; color: #333333}
.bodyHome {  background-image: url(img/P_fond.jpg); background-repeat: repeat}
.extTable {  border: #990000; border-style: solid; border-top-width: 2px; border-right-width: 2px; border-bottom-width: 2px; border-left-width: 2px}
.tdMenuHome {  background-color: #990000; padding-top: 0px; padding-right: 0px; padding-bottom: 0px; padding-left: 10px}
.aMenuGauche {  font-weight: bold; color: #FFFFFF; text-decoration: none}
.plHome {  font-family: Georgia, "Times New Roman", Times, serif; font-size: 24px; font-weight: 900; color: #FFFFFF; letter-spacing: -1px; word-spacing: -1px; vertical-align: middle}
.tdRubriqueHome {  font-weight: bold; color: #990000; background-color: #F0F0F0; border: #990000 solid; padding-top: 12px; padding-right: 15px; padding-bottom: 8px; padding-left: 15px; border-width: 1px 0px 0px}
.smallCaps {  font-variant: small-caps}
.tdMainHome {  background-color: #FFFFFF; padding-top: 8px; padding-right: 20px; padding-bottom: 5px; padding-left: 20px}
.legendHome {  font-size: 10px; font-weight: bold; color: #FFFFFF}
.plHomeSousTitre { font-family: Georgia, "Times New Roman", Times, serif; font-size: 14px; font-weight: bold; color: #FFFFFF; letter-spacing: -1px; word-spacing: -1px ; vertical-align: middle}
.test {  border: #990000; border-style: solid; border-top-width: 1px; border-right-width: 0px; border-bottom-width: 0px; border-left-width: 0px}
.tdAdresseBook { font-size: 10px; color: #333333; border: #990000; border-style: solid; border-top-width: 1px; border-right-width: 0px; border-bottom-width: 0px; border-left-width: 0px ; text-align: center; padding-top: 2px; padding-right: 0px; padding-bottom: 2px; padding-left: 0px}
.tdAdresseHome { font-size: 10px; color: #333333; border: #990000 solid; text-align: center; padding-top: 2px; padding-right: 0px; padding-bottom: 2px; padding-left: 0px ; background-color: #FFFFFF; border-width: 0px 0px 1px}
.tdQuoteBook {  font-size: 12px; font-style: italic; color: #FFFFFF; padding-top: 5px; padding-right: 10px; padding-bottom: 5px; padding-left: 10px; font-weight: bold; background-color: #990000; border: #FFFFFF solid; border-width: 0px 0px 1px 1px}
.aSsMenu { color: #990000; text-decoration: none; font-size: 12px; font-weight: bold }
.tdSsMenuActif {  background-image: url(img/ombreTopAct.jpg); background-repeat: repeat-x}
.tdSsMenu { background-image: url(img/ombreNormaleAct.jpg); background-repeat: repeat-x}
.tdSsMenuG { background-image: url(img/ombreGaucheAct.jpg); background-repeat: no-repeat}
.tdSsMenuD { background-image: url(img/ombreDroiteAct.jpg); background-repeat: no-repeat }
.aSsMenuI { color: #FFFFFF; text-decoration: none; font-size: 12px; font-weight: bold }
.tdSsMenuInactif {  background-image: url(img/ombreTopInact.jpg); background-repeat: repeat-x}
.tdSsMenuGI { background-image: url(img/ombreGaucheInact.jpg); background-repeat: no-repeat}
.tdSsMenuDI { background-image: url(img/ombreDroiteInact.jpg); background-repeat: no-repeat }
.detailsSmall {  font-size: 9px; color: #990000; padding-top: 0px; padding-right: 10px; padding-bottom: 0px; padding-left: 10px}
.vu {  position: static; visibility: visible; clip:  rect(   )}
.pasVu {  position: static; visibility: hidden; display: none; clip:  rect(   )}
.aList {  font-size: 10px; font-weight: bold; color: #FFFFFF; text-decoration: none; padding-top: 0px; padding-right: 5px; padding-bottom: 0px; padding-left: -15px}
.divBook {
	color: #333333; 
	overflow: auto; 
	position: relative; 
	clip:                   rect(   ); 
	width: 100%; 
	height: 330px; 
	padding-top: 0px; 
	padding-right: 15px; 
	padding-bottom: 0px; 
	padding-left: 0px; 
	text-align: left; 
	border: 0px #FFFFFF solid
	}
.tdLogo {  background-color: #990000; border: #FFFFFF solid; border-width: 0px 1px 1px 0px}
.traitDroit {  border: #990000 solid; border-width: 0px 1px 0px 0px}
.photoDansTexte { float: left; margin-top: 0px; margin-right: 15px; margin-bottom: 5px; margin-left: 0px}
.tdMenuBook { background-color: #666666; padding-top: 0px; padding-right: 0px; padding-bottom: 0px; padding-left: 10px }
.tdTitrePage { font-size: 14px; font-style: normal; color: #FFFFFF; padding-top: 5px; padding-right: 10px; padding-bottom: 5px; padding-left: 10px; font-weight: bold; background-color: #990000; border: #FFFFFF solid; border-width: 0px 0px 1px 1px ; text-align: right}
.aSsMenuCatlog { color: #990000; text-decoration: none; font-size: 11px; font-weight: normal}
.aSsMenuICatlog { color: #FFFFFF; text-decoration: none; font-size: 11px; font-weight: normal}
.groupHeader {  font-size: 16px; font-weight: 900; color: #990000; border: #990000; border-style: solid; border-top-width: 2px; border-right-width: 0px; border-bottom-width: 1px; border-left-width: 0px}
.catGroupHeader {  font-size: 14px; font-weight: 900; color: #FFFFFF; background-color: #990000; padding-top: 3px; padding-right: 0px; padding-bottom: 3px; padding-left: 154px; position: relative; clip:  rect(   )}
.divOnglet { 
	position: relative; 
	width: 400px; 
	height: 20px; 
	z-index: 1; 
	background-image: url(img/ongletDetails.jpg); 
	background-repeat: no-repeat; 
	layer-background-color: #00FF00; 
	border: 1px #000000 none;
	padding: 4px 10px 2px; clip:  rect(   )}
.divDetailsOn { 
	position: relative; 
	visibility: visible; 
	clip:     rect(   ); 
	z-index: 1; 
	layer-background-color: #FFFFFF; 
	border: 1px #990000 solid;
	padding: 5px 10px; overflow: auto; height: 312px; width: 100%}
.divDetailsOff {  position: static; visibility: hidden; display: none; clip:  rect(   )}

a {  color: #660000}
.tdDetailsOngletRouge {  background-image: url(img/ongletDetailsRouge.gif); background-repeat: no-repeat; color: #FFFFFF; text-align: center; padding-top: 2px; padding-right: 0px; padding-bottom: 1px; padding-left: 0px; cursor: hand}
.tdDetailsOngletGris {  background-image: url(img/ongletDetailsGris.gif); color: #333333; text-align: center; padding-top: 2px; padding-right: 0px; padding-bottom: 1px; padding-left: 0px; cursor: hand}
.divBookDetails { color: #333333; overflow: hidden; position: relative; clip:  rect(   ); width: 100%; height: 330px; padding-top: 0px; padding-right: 15px; padding-bottom: 0px; padding-left: 0px; text-align: left; border: 0px #FFFFFF solid }
.aPlan {  font-size: 11px; color: #333333; text-decoration: none; clip:   rect(   )}
.classiqueTitre {  color: #333333; margin-top: 10px; margin-right: 0px; margin-bottom: 0px; margin-left: 0px; border: double; text-align: center; padding-top: 5px; padding-right: 0px; padding-bottom: 5px; padding-left: 0px; border-width: 4px 0px 1px; border-color: #666666 #990000 #990000}
.traitHaut { border: #990000 solid; border-width: 1px 0px 0px}
.aNews {  font-weight: bold; color: #FFFFFF}
.legendPhoto { font-size: 10px; font-weight: normal; color: #990000; font-style: italic}

